Frequently Asked Questions about Windermere

How much are Studio apartments in Windermere?

There are currently 17 Studio Apartments in Windermere with rent ranges from $819 to $1,526 with an average price of $1,167.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Windermere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Windermere ranges from $633 to $2,362 with an average monthly rent of $1,025.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Windermere c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Windermere range from $700 to $3,544.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,297.

How expensive are Windermere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 8 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Windermere on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,123 to $3,600 - averaging $2,425 for the location.
